[Qemu-block] [PATCH 10/15] nbd: allow setting of an export name for qemu-nbd server |
Date: |
Fri, 27 Nov 2015 12:20:48 +0000 |
The qemu-nbd server currently always uses the old style protocol
since it never sets any export name. This is a problem because
future TLS support will require use of the new style protocol
negotiation.
This adds a "--exportname NAME" argument to qemu-nbd which allows
the user to set an explicit export name. When --exportname is
set the server will always use the new style protocol.
